Herbert Street is in Bacup and in Rossendale district. OL13 0TY is located in the Britannia & Lee Mill elect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Rossendale and Darwen.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Is Herbert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Herbert Street was 133.3 per 1,000 residents, which is 76.2% higher than the Britannia & Lee Mill average. The most reported crime type was Anti-social behaviour.

Herbert Street has the 16th highest crime rate of 41 local areas in Britannia & Lee Mill and the 62nd highest crime rate of 224 local areas in Rossendale .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 33.3 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-27.2%.

OL13 0TY area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 3%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
